























About game Soccer Heads
Rating
5
(votes: 10)
Release
06.07.2017
Platform
Windows, Chrome OS, Linux, MacOS, Android, iOS
Category
Description
The head in football is no less important than the legs and you will see for yourself if you play our game. The football stars lined up and are waiting for your decision. Make a choice and in the allotted time of the match, defeat the opponent, scoring a record number of goals. If you manage to collect bonuses, they will help to win faster.